Calculate the pH of a buffer solution that contains 0.25 M benzoic acid (C 6H 5CO 2H) and 0.15M sodium benzoate (C

In this case, for the calculation of the pH of the given buffer we need to use the Henderson-Hasselbach equation:

[tex]pH=pKa+log(\frac{[base]}{[acid]} )[/tex]

Whereas the pKa for benzoic acid is 4.19, the concentration of the base is 0.15 M (sodium benzoate) and the concentration of the acid is 0.25 M (benzoic acid), therefore, the pH turns out:

[tex]pH=4.19+log(\frac{0.15M}{0.25M} )\\\\pH=3.97[/tex]
